1. Vitamin C

Vitamin C isn’t only vital for overall health however, it’s also an effective treatment for dental bacteria since its antioxidant properties help fight infections and help build strong gums, according to Dr. Louie who suggests that people with bleeding gums should consider taking a Vitamin C supplements.

Vitamin C is a water-soluble vitamin present in fruits and vegetables. To reap the maximum health benefits It is recommended that you consume at minimum 75 mg of Vitamin C daily.

It is crucial to be aware that the most effective method to boost your intake of vitamin C is through fresh vegetables like carrots, spinach and oranges. Foods without added sugar tend to be greater natural sources of this vital nutrient. Therefore, making sure to include these items in your meals and snacks is beneficial.

Eating a diet high in Vitamin C is the best method to avoid dental diseases. In addition, this eating regimen benefits your immune system because it aids in fighting off infections.

Vitamin C’s antioxidant properties are essential for the creation of collagen. This helps maintain periodontal structures such as the gingiva, periodontal ligament , and cementum, in addition to alveolar bone. Additionally Vitamin C has the capacity to decrease inflammation in the mouth and aid in periodontal tissue healing.

3. Zinc

Zinc is a vital mineral that is essential for maintaining good dental health. It is beneficial for many reasons, such as preventing gum disease.

It helps protect against the effects of oxidative stress and cell membrane breakdown caused by bacteria which cause gingivitis. Furthermore, it inhibits in the creation of hydrogen peroxide which can cause irritation to your mouth when inhaled.

Zinc is abundant in the dental hard tissues, particularly the enamel as well as dentine. Your enamel is composed of calcium hydroxyapatite with crystal structure that zinc aids in creating. The result is that your enamel becomes harder and more resistant to dental caries.

Zinc toothpaste has been scientifically proven to lower the amount of plaque and reduce calculus growth, safeguarding the teeth against decay as well as tooth loss. In addition, it can reduce acid production as well as aid in remineralization and strengthening the enamel.

Additionally, it helps reduce the smell caused from the volatile sulfur compound (VSCs) in your breath. This smell develops when bacteria digest food leftovers in your mouth and release this gas.
